diff --git a/profile/deletePrefLoc.php b/profile/deletePrefLoc.php new file mode 100644 index 0000000000000000000000000000000000000000..125e3c9ec0031e6db69ca987d57cb89d84e7fad8 --- /dev/null +++ b/profile/deletePrefLoc.php @@ -0,0 +1,10 @@ +<?php + include '../database/dbconnect.php'; + $user_id = $_GET['id']; + $deletedLoc = $_GET['loc']; + $query = mysqli_query($con,"DELETE FROM driver_prefloc WHERE user_id='".$user_id."' AND pref_loc='".$deletedLoc."'") or die(mysqli_error($con)); + mysqli_close($con); + if ($query) { + header("Location: edit_location.php?id=$user_id"); + } +?> diff --git a/profile/edit_location.php b/profile/edit_location.php index 0d25d1d0d45e7caf68d3823020d603bf05cbe637..b35459faee835ec3b7d7b1ae1df3877ee95162a6 100644 --- a/profile/edit_location.php +++ b/profile/edit_location.php @@ -45,9 +45,9 @@ while($row=mysqli_fetch_assoc($query)) { echo ' <tr> <td>'.$i.'</td> - <td>'.$row['pref_loc'].'</td> - <td><div class="edit_button">✎</div><div class="delete_button">✖</div></td> - </tr>'; + <td>'.$row['pref_loc'].'</td> + <td><div class="edit_button">✎</div><div class="delete_button"><a href="'deletePrefLoc.php?id='.$user_id.'%26&loc='.$row['pref_loc']'">✖</a></div></td> + </tr>'; $i++; } } diff --git a/profile/updateLocation.php b/profile/updateLocation.php index e2468caf320c99242ffaeb26bd018df6245248df..0334b045fe99ce117ac6c22eb33d59ae827dd4a0 100644 --- a/profile/updateLocation.php +++ b/profile/updateLocation.php @@ -5,6 +5,7 @@ $user_id = $_POST['hidden_userid']; $new_loc = $_POST['new_location']; $query = mysqli_query($con,"INSERT INTO driver_prefloc (driver_id,pref_loc) VALUES ('$user_id', '$new_loc')") or die(mysqli_error($con)); + mysqli_close($con); if ($query) { header("Location: edit_location.php?id=$user_id"); }